Sabin Adhikaree Life Story

Sabin Adhikaree's journey began in the bustling streets of Kathmandu, Nepal, in 1975. From a young age, he exhibited a curious mind and a compassionate heart that would define his life's path. In the summer of 1999, he embarked on a new chapter, leaving behind his homeland to pursue opportunities in the United States, landing in the sunny state of Florida.

It was in Irving, Texas, in 2000, where Sabin found his footing and began to build the foundation of his future. He completed his Bachelors and Masters in the field of IT from UT Arlington. With determination and diligence, he carved out a career in the field of Information Technology, eventually becoming a seasoned database specialist and architect with over two decades of invaluable experience. His passion for technology was infectious, and he dedicated himself to nurturing and guiding others in their career pursuits within the tech industry.

In the summer of 2006, Sabin found his greatest joy when he married the love of his life, Rakshya Adhikari. Together, they welcomed their son, Aaryav, into the world in February 2011, completing their family and filling their home with boundless love and laughter. The move to Keller, Texas, in the same year provided a serene backdrop for their growing family and offered Sabin the tranquility he cherished.

Despite his demanding career, Sabin always made time for the things he loved. He was a devoted father, uncle, son, and friend, known for his unwavering kindness, generosity, and warm smile that could light up any room. His gentle demeanor and caring nature touched the lives of all who knew him, earning him the admiration and respect of many.

In his leisure moments, Sabin found solace in simple pleasures. He delighted in cooking for his family, his culinary creations a reflection of his love and creativity. Music, particularly the soothing melodies of Jazz Pop, provided a soundtrack to his life, with Nora Jones holding a special place in his heart. He found inspiration in the wonders of the world through travel shows and documentaries, and he reveled in the beauty of nature, especially the vastness of the ocean.

On April 15th, 2024, Sabin Adhikaree's journey on this earth came to an end, leaving behind a legacy of love, laughter, and kindness. Though he may no longer walk among us, his spirit lives on in the hearts of those he touched, forever cherished by his beloved wife Rakshya, his adoring son Aaryav, his devoted parents Damodar Prasad and Gayatri Devi, his dear sister Sabina, and all who were fortunate enough to call him friend. Sabin's memory will continue to shine brightly, a beacon of light guiding us through the darkest of days.
